Definitions from Wiktionary (polymorph)
▸ noun: (biology) Any organism that shows polymorphism.
▸ noun: (chemistry, geology) Any substance or mineral that forms different types of crystal.
▸ noun: (transitive, fiction) The transformation of an item or creature into something different by magic.
▸ verb: (intransitive) To transform; to change into another form.
▸ verb: (fiction, ambitransitive) To transform into something different by magic.
